|
AALanguage
The best language for those who have nothing to do
|
This is the complete list of members for Poliz, including all inherited members.
| add_tid_values(TableIdentifiers *current_tid, bool is_first=true) | Poliz | private |
| ADDRESS enum value | Poliz | |
| address_to_value(void *ptr) | Poliz | |
| ASSIGN enum value | Poliz | |
| BITWISE_AND enum value | Poliz | |
| BITWISE_CONS enum value | Poliz | |
| BITWISE_OR enum value | Poliz | |
| BITWISE_SHIFT enum value | Poliz | |
| BITWISE_XOR enum value | Poliz | |
| blank() | Poliz | |
| BLANK enum value | Poliz | |
| BOOL_LITERAL enum value | Poliz | |
| BYTE_LITERAL enum value | Poliz | |
| CALL enum value | Poliz | |
| call_function(std::stack< std::pair< PolizType, void * > > &st, int &p) | Poliz | |
| CHAR_LITERAL enum value | Poliz | |
| clear_tid_values(TableIdentifiers *current_tid) | Poliz | private |
| CMP enum value | Poliz | |
| COMMA enum value | Poliz | |
| convert(std::pair< PolizType, void * > op, PolizType to) | Poliz | |
| CONVERT enum value | Poliz | |
| copy_value(void *ptr) | Poliz | |
| current_function | Poliz | private |
| DOUBLE_LITERAL enum value | Poliz | |
| EQUALITY enum value | Poliz | |
| execute(Function entry_func) | Poliz | |
| execute_operation(std::pair< PolizType, void * > op1, std::pair< PolizType, void * > op2, std::string operation) | Poliz | |
| execute_operation(std::pair< PolizType, void * > op, std::string operation) | Poliz | |
| EXIT enum value | Poliz | |
| FGO enum value | Poliz | |
| FLOAT_LITERAL enum value | Poliz | |
| func_calls | Poliz | private |
| get_size() | Poliz | |
| GETARR enum value | Poliz | |
| GETSTR enum value | Poliz | |
| global_lexes | Poliz | private |
| GO enum value | Poliz | |
| INT_LITERAL enum value | Poliz | |
| LABEL enum value | Poliz | |
| LARGE_LITERAL enum value | Poliz | |
| lexes | Poliz | private |
| LITERAL enum value | Poliz | |
| literal_prior | Poliz | private |
| LOGICAL_AND enum value | Poliz | |
| LOGICAL_OR enum value | Poliz | |
| LONG_LITERAL enum value | Poliz | |
| make_same(std::pair< PolizType, void * > op1, std::pair< PolizType, void * > op2) | Poliz | |
| MULT enum value | Poliz | |
| NORET enum value | Poliz | |
| operator[](int ind) | Poliz | inline |
| PLUS enum value | Poliz | |
| POINTER enum value | Poliz | |
| Poliz() | Poliz | inline |
| Poliz(Type *current_function) | Poliz | |
| PolizType enum name | Poliz | |
| PRINT enum value | Poliz | |
| put_lex(std::pair< PolizType, void * > l) | Poliz | |
| RAND enum value | Poliz | |
| READ enum value | Poliz | |
| READLN enum value | Poliz | |
| ReplaceAll(std::string str, const std::string &from, const std::string &to) | Poliz | private |
| restore_tid_values() | Poliz | private |
| RET enum value | Poliz | |
| rnd | Poliz | private |
| SEMICOLON enum value | Poliz | |
| SHORT_LITERAL enum value | Poliz | |
| STACK_PLUG enum value | Poliz | |
| STRING_LITERAL enum value | Poliz | |
| string_to_type(std::string str) | Poliz | private |
| STRLEN enum value | Poliz | |
| SWITCH_CMP enum value | Poliz | |
| SWITCH_POP enum value | Poliz | |
| TGO enum value | Poliz | |
| tid_vals | Poliz | private |
| TIME enum value | Poliz | |
| type_to_poliz(ExprType type) | Poliz | |
| UINT_LITERAL enum value | Poliz | |
| ULONG_LITERAL enum value | Poliz | |
| UNARY enum value | Poliz | |
| USING enum value | Poliz | |
| ~Poliz() | Poliz |